Catalogue of 286 Managed Aquifer Recharge Sites in Europe

Experts working on Managed Aquifer Recharge (MAR) as part of the DEMEAU project compiled a catalogue of 286 MAR-sites in Europe. The data will be included in an existing online data portal and serves as a basis for further risk assessment and recommendations concerning the authorization of European MAR sties in line with EU legislation.

D11.1 Development of a Catalogue on European MAR Sites: Documentation

In order to demonstrate the effects of typical existing European MAR systems onto groundwater availability and groundwater quality with specific focus on trace organics, a comprehensive relational database (catalogue) on European MAR systems was created to ensure efficient management of available data. By means of the built-in user forms, queries, and reports, database users are enabled to not only view and enter records but also to quickly process the data to extract needed information.

Putting in vitro bioassay results in perspective – a concept for deriving human health based bioassay trigger values

The application of in vitro bioassays receives increasing attention for water quality assessment. A major advantage of bioassays is that they provide an integrated biological response concerning e.g. hormonal activity in environmental waters and (sources of) drinking water. In order to integrate bioassays into legislation and with that into the practice of risk assessment for water supply, adequate limit values are needed.
